 What is the Cosmic Christ?  Essentially the Cosmic Christ is Cosmic Love, One whose Being is Love of a Cosmic frequency and whose purpose it is to be an intermediary of Divine Love to all the star groups and solar systems within the Cosmic Logos.  He is the Heart center of the Deity whom we call the ”One About

Whom Naught May Be Said.”  This Being embraces the Great Bear, the Sirius System, and the Pleiades, Orion and all the great stars of the twelve zodiacal constellations. This includes more than 20,000 solar systems. And since we could certainly imagine a Cosmic Christ who corresponds to the Galactic Heart center and beyond, we use the term “Cosmic Christ” for all the Christ levels beyond the Christ Being of a Solar Logos. 

 This quality of Christ Love can be described as sacrifice…as God manifesting Him/Herself in the world of matter in order to bring into all beings a deep experience and expression of Divine Love and a redemption from form.  A.A.B. states in “From Bethlehem to Calvary” pg.67-68, “First matter dominant, enthroned and triumphant.  Then matter, the custodian of hidden Divinity, beauty, and reality, ready to bring them to birth.  Finally matter as the servant of that which has been born, the Christ.  However, none of this is brought about unless the journey is made from Nazareth, the place of consecration and from Galilee, the place of the daily round of life; and this is true, whether one is speaking of the Cosmic Christ, hidden by the form of a solar system; of the mythic Christ, hidden in humanity down the ages; of the historical Christ, concealed within the form of Jesus; or of the individual Christ, hidden within ordinary man.  For always the routine is the same—the journey, new birth, the experience of life, the service to be rendered, the death to be endured, and then the resurrection into more extended service.”

 Sirius is, basically, a fixed star, the brightest in our heavens and is a binary star, having a white dwarf companion star, a solar moon orbiting it.  It is is 8.7 light-years away from us.  It is destined to become a black hole because of its mass.

It has been called the star of Mercury or Budha, the great instructor of mankind and so it is a Great Illuminator.  It is said that as the Soul is to the personality, Sirius is to our Sun…therefore it could be said to be the Soul of our Solar Logos.  This puts it in direct relationship then to the Cosmic Christ…Who is, in His Infinite Vastness, the Source of Love/Wisdom through all Souls, though all Hearts. 

 

Sirius, as a transmitter of 2nd Ray, Love/Wisdom energies originating from the Cosmic Christ, is in triangular relationship with The Great Bear who transmits 1st Ray energies and The Pleiades which transmits 3rd Ray energies.  The Golden Triangle mentioned earlier from The Old Commentary does not mention Sirius, but a relationship does exist between Sirius, Gemini and Venus.  Firstly, the Tibetan speaks, in EA, pg. 348 about a cosmic triangle existing between Gemini, The Great Bear and the Pleiades.  He calls this the triangle of the Cosmic Christ and says it is the esoteric symbol lying behind the Cosmic Cross.  Ray 2, the Ray of Love/Wisdom pours through Sirius from that Great Illuminator to Gemini…a point of entrance and the head of this Cosmic Cross, thus illustrating the occult truth that Love underlies the entire universe.  “God is Love” says the Tibetan, “and this is an exoteric and esoteric truth.”
